1

Poll

What if I break the class up into six (6) groups, then I survey everyone in two (2) randomly chosen groups but no one in the other groups?

convenience sampling

cluster sampling

systematic sampling

stratified sampling

simple random sampling

2

Poll

What if I break the class up into six (6) groups, then I survey two (2) random people from each of the groups?

convenience sampling

cluster sampling

systematic sampling

stratified sampling

simple random sampling

3

Poll

What if I break the class up into six (6) groups, then I survey everyone from the group closest to me?

convenience sampling

cluster sampling

systematic sampling

stratified sampling

simple random sampling

4

Poll

What if I randomly choose students from the entire class using a spinner wheel with everyone's name on it?

convenience sampling

cluster sampling

systematic sampling

stratified sampling

simple random sampling

5

Poll

What if I choose every 4th student who enters the room?

convenience sampling

cluster sampling

systematic sampling

stratified sampling

simple random sampling
